I noticed in a bunch of tutorials, that some source code includes the window.h file. When I use that file, my compliers says that i do not have a window.h file. The compiler i use is dJGPP.
What is the windows.h file and what does it do?

windows.h is for creating win32 programs.
DJGPP is a protected mode DOS compiler.
